    Pneumonia with Pleurisy
    
            What is it?
 Inflammation of the membranes that surround the lung (pleura).
Symptoms:
- 
Chills
 
- 
Fever 
 
- 
A cough that may produce bloody or foul-smelling sputum
 
- 
Chest pain when taking a breath or coughing
 
Unlike a true heart attack, pleurisy pain is usually relieved temporarily by holding your breath or putting pressure on the painful area of your chest.
If you've recently been diagnosed with pneumonia and then start having symptoms of pleurisy, contact your health care provider or seek immediate medical attention to determine the cause of your chest pain. Pleurisy alone isn't a medical emergency, but you shouldn't try to make the diagnosis yourself.
